Questions : Which one of the following pairs (Nations and Capitals) is not correctly matched?

(a) Ethiopia - Addis Ababa

(b) North Korea - Seoul

(c) Chile - Santiago

(d) Argentina - Buenos Aires

The correct answers to the above question in:

Answer: (b)

Question : 1

Which one of the following is not correctly matched?

a) Russia – Moscow

b) Australia - Camberra

c) China - Shanghai

d) Canada - Ottawa

Answer: (c)

Question : 2

Match List-I with List-II and select the correct answer using the code given below the lists.

List I List II
(Old Name) (New Name)
A. Siam 1. Taiwan
B. Formosa 2. Myanmar
C. Mesopotamia 3. Thailand
D. Burma 4. Iraq
Codes: A B C D

a) 3 1 4 2

b) 1 3 2 4

c) 2 1 3 4

d) 4 2 1 3

Answer: (a)

Question : 4

International Date line is

a) 180° east-west longitude

b) 90° east longitude

c) equator

d) 0° longitude

Answer: (a)

The international data line is located about 180°E (or 180° W) of Greenwich.

Question : 6

Which of the following statements is true about South Sudan?

  1. It is a land-locked country.
  2. It’s capital is located in Akoba.
  3. Its main river is White Nile.
  4. Its main religion is Islam.
Use the code given below for the correct answer.

a) 2 and 4

b) 1 and 3

c) 1 and 2

d) 2 and 3

Answer: (b)
